Godmanchester Church. Carved misericords on S. side of Chancel, late 15th-century.

(1) Fox carrying off goose.

(3) Angel holding shield.

(4) Crouching lion.

(5) Lion's mask.

(6) Reclining horse.

(7) Cat with mouse.

(8) Eagle holding scroll.

(9) Dappled fawn, crouching.
